Bärenreiter’s new scholarly-critical edition of op. 87 edited by Christopher Hogwood is based on the score and parts from the first edition; where necessary he also consulted the autograph. The first edition parts were engraved after the manuscript parts and not after the score. Here the readings of the legato phrasing and the dynamics more accurately reflect the composer’s intentions than in the first edition score.
